Transaction 51d8781188342494d3a9e6660d71fa5d95634db3d143b165984d305af350b247

2 Input
2 Outputs
  • 51d8781188342494d3a9e6660d71fa5d95634db3d143b165984d305af350b247:0
  • value  43074
    address  1A1XNwvZsYRjry3rfS9ir3p9ZCCJ8ZBJjp
  • 51d8781188342494d3a9e6660d71fa5d95634db3d143b165984d305af350b247:1
  • value  28972
    address  1MmpPzyFdNqbNRSA2eb3ysq2FWZHcMAx1h